About the role
As an Access Control Officer at a healthcare location, you will manage entry points, verify credentials, monitor access activity, conduct routine patrols, and respond to security-related concerns. Responsibilities
- Provide customer service to patients, visitors, staff, and contractors by carrying out access-control procedures, site-specific policies, and when appropriate, emergency response activities at a healthcare location.
- Monitor entry points, verify credentials and visitor authorization, issue visitor passes as directed, and maintain accurate access-related records.
- Respond to incidents and critical situations in a calm, problem-solving manner, including access concerns, unauthorized entry attempts, and emergency notifications.
- Communicate professionally with facility personnel and Allied Universal leadership regarding access-control issues, suspicious activity, and policy violations.
- Conduct regular and random patrols of assigned entry areas, adjacent business spaces, and perimeter locations to help deter unauthorized access.
